The Internet Journal of Medical Education
ISSN: 2155-6725

Within the context of medical and health sciences' education, issues covered by The Internet Journal of Medical Education include, but are not limited to:

  • Curriculum design, development and delivery
  • Assessment and evaluation
  • Teaching methods - reviewing older methods and describing newer methods
  • Opportunities and challenges
  • Innovations
  • Distance education
  • Online education
  • Informal education
  • Educational governance
  • Quality issues
  • Education for the lay person
  • History of education
  • Ethics in education
  • Students' prceptions
  • International models
  • Faculty development, support & scholarship
  • Inter-professional education

Please note that, if data on participants are used, a statement indicating informed consent of participants, and ethics' approval by a review board, or a statement indicating why this is not necessary, is required.

This is a peer reviewed journal. Every published article has been reviewed by members of the editorial board and the editor-in-chief. All articles are archived by Internet Scientific Publications LLC and recognized by The Library of Congress Catalog of Publications.
